MAN CHARGED FOR ATTENDING SOCIAL GATHERING AT CIRCUIT ROAD.

According to a MOH media release, A 38-year-old man was charged in court after being caught for attending a gathering at a women’s place during the circuit breaker period. Soh Seng Chye Francis was charged under the Section 34(7) of the COVID-19 (Temporary Measures) Act 2020, after allegedly contravening Regulation 6 of the COVID-19 (Temporary Measures) (Control Order) Regulations 2020.

The incident happened on the evening of 08 Apr 2020 which lasted for an hour. The gathering involved five others who are from the same household.

According to the law, an individual who is not living in the same residences is not allowed to gather from 07 Apr 2020 – 01 Jun 2020. Anyone caught will be smack with a heavy $10000 fine, 6 months jail term, or both.
